Tip – When you are searching for a victorian style conservatory in and around Glasgow G44 bear in mind that 16mm Polycarbonate roofing systems are now only used in very basic conservatories it is not considered technically efficient any longer by most quality home improvement companies. Most provide 25mm polycarbonate as standard and will offer you the choice of clear bronze or opal tints at no extra cost.
Tip – If you are looking for a victorian style conservatory in and around Glasgow G44 consider buying a DIY conservatory and get a local builder to install it. This may be a cheaper alternative than the fully installed option but easier and less risky than the full DIY route.
